Meta’s WhatsApp Business AI Agent: The News
Meta just threw down the gauntlet. As of June 3, 2026, Meta’s AI agent for WhatsApp Business is available globally. Businesses can now deploy Meta’s conversational AI directly inside WhatsApp, but there’s a catch: pricing is based on token usage, not flat fees. This is a seismic moment for AI agent adoption—one of the world’s most popular business messaging platforms now comes with a built-in AI agent, but it’s pay-as-you-go and tightly controlled by Meta.
Meta’s global rollout means that any business with a WhatsApp Business account can activate the AI agent. The agent handles customer queries, automates responses, and integrates with business workflows. But there’s no escaping the meter: every word, every interaction, is a billable event. This is not a SaaS subscription. It’s a usage-based toll booth, and Meta controls the gate.

The Real Cost: Token Pricing and Platform Lock-In
Let’s be blunt: Meta’s token-based pricing is a double-edged sword. On one hand, you pay only for what you use. On the other, you have zero predictability. A viral campaign, a customer service spike, or a bot gone rogue can turn your bill into a shock. There’s no cap, no custom negotiation, and no way to optimize for your unique workflow.
